Further delays to 5G

Føroya Tele began its transition from 4G to 5G in August last year with the aim of completing the project by the end of 2022.
However, with global supply chain issues slowing down delivery of technical equipment such as microchips, the completion date was first postponed until late March.

And now it has again been put back a few months.
“We have had some problems caused by the global chip shortage,” says Símun Skaalum, managing director of Føroya Tele’s communication division FT Samskifti.

“We then had some additional logistical issues related to our transition from Huawei to Ericsson equipment. We expect to have the 5G network up and running by the end of Q3 of this year.”
